In another inspirational episode @SriMati responds directly to a question from listener Tracey on creativity. How does the doyenne of plant based not-cheese manage multiple creative outlets, a brand new intentional food business and a large, active family? Recorded during Navratri, in reverence to and devotion of the goddess, Julie explores feminine energy as the eternal creator. This is the frequency that will continue to create for all eternity and the more unified we are with it, the more prolific we will be. If we feel into ourselves as a sphere of radiant energy, always moving and always emanating, we can spontaneously turn our attention towards expression, experiencing joyful vitality instead of restless anxiety and letting go of our preoccupation with linear processes, invented goals and dreaded to-do lists.
